2025-26 (Freshman):
Competed in all eight meets this season, including the NAIA National Championship… Finished 26th in the NAIA in the the 200-yard butterfly (1:56.73), 29th nationally int he 400-yard IM (4:16.26), and 36th place in the 500-yard freestyle (4:51.18) at the national meet… Had a personal-best time in the 400-yard IM (4:08.28) at the Sun Conference Championship in February.Â

Pre-Loyola:
A native of New Orleans, Louisiana, he graduated from Brother Martin High School, where he swam under coach Kevin Watkins... Crescioni served as team captain, earned the Coaches Award, and was named Team MVP during his high school career...
